Answering or postponing a second call

To answer or postpone a second call, you need to first enable the call waiting option by doing the following:

1.From the Home screen, select Start > Settings > Phone > Call Waiting.

2.Press the Action key. A tick is placed in the box.

3.Select Done.

Once the call waiting option has been enabled on your Toshiba phone and the settings have automatically been sent and accepted by your Service Provider, you will receive an audible and visual notification on your Toshiba phone if another call comes in during your current call.

To put the first call on hold and answer the second call, press the Send key. To switch between calls, select Swap.
